Dental implants

Dental implants are highly favored as the preferred method for replacing missing teeth. But they do require a certain type of environment to work properly. Ideal candidates for implants have adequate bone level, a healthy oral environment and are also in good general health. If you have lost bone due to gum disease, chronic tooth loss or other factors, you may need a bone grafting procedure first to rebuild the bone your new implants will need for success.

Dental implants offer unique benefits that include:

  • Restoration of biting function
  • Unparalleled stability and durability
  • Natural, esthetic appearance
  • Enjoyment of favorite foods
  • Permanent tooth replacement with proper care
  • Improved quality of life
  • Greater self-confidence
  • Preservation of jaw bone health

Gum Disease

Gum Disease increases the risk of heart disease, placing those with the oral condition at a 50 percent higher chance of having a heart attack. Researchers believe harmful bacteria from the mouth travel through the bloodstream, possibly contributing to inflammation within the cardiovascular system. It is also believed that this inflammatory response influences the increased risk of stroke in gum disease patients.

Laser Gum Disease Treatment.

Gum Disease Threatens More Than Your Smile. Gum disease is a serious oral condition affecting nearly half of all U.S. adults age 30 and over. Caused by hundreds of types of harmful oral bacteria, its effects extend well beyond the smile. Gum disease not only leads to loss of bone that supports the teeth – the progressive infection is the number one cause of adult tooth loss today. It is also linked to several systemic health conditions, including heart disease, stroke and diabetes, among others. Given its concerning effects, treating gum disease in a timely manner is extremely important.
